I see I can e-file a deceased person's tax return. I am the personal representative appointed by the court, and the deceased person is due a refund. Can I e-file a Form 1310 with the Letters Testamentary? Or should I just paper file everything?
You'll need to sign in or create an account to connect with an expert.
You cannot e-file Form 1310. You can still e-file the a tax return and mail Form 1310 separately or you can mail the form in with the tax return.
